It seems like you have provided three mathematical equations:
- ( y = 3x )
- ( y = 3x^4 + 2 )
- ( y = 3x^3 - 1 )
If you're looking to analyze these equations, there are a few things we could do:
1. Graphing the Functions
You can graph each function to visualize how they behave. Each of these equations represents a different polynomial function:
- The first function, ( y = 3x ), is a linear function, which is a straight line through the origin with a slope of 3.
- The second function, ( y = 3x^4 + 2 ), is a quartic function which will have a positive leading coefficient. This means its ends will rise to positive infinity as ( x ) approaches both positive and negative infinity, and it will shift vertically upwards by 2.
- The third function, ( y = 3x^3 - 1 ), is a cubic function. It has a point of inflection and will cross the y-axis at -1. The leading coefficient (3) indicates it also rises to positive infinity as ( x ) approaches positive infinity and falls to negative infinity as ( x ) approaches negative infinity.
2. Finding Intersections
You may want to find points where these curves intersect. To find intersection points, you can set the equations equal to each other:
Intersection of ( y = 3x ) and ( y = 3x^4 + 2 ): [ 3x = 3x^4 + 2 ] Rearranging gives: [ 3x^4 - 3x + 2 = 0 ]
Intersection of ( y = 3x ) and ( y = 3x^3 - 1 ): [ 3x = 3x^3 - 1 ] Rearranging gives: [ 3x^3 - 3x - 1 = 0 ]
Intersection of ( y = 3x^4 + 2 ) and ( y = 3x^3 - 1 ): [ 3x^4 + 2 = 3x^3 - 1 ] Rearranging gives: [ 3x^4 - 3x^3 + 3 = 0 ]
3. Derivatives
If you're studying calculus, you may want to find the derivative of these equations to analyze their rates of change or critical points:
- ( y' = 3 ) (for ( y = 3x ))
- ( y' = 12x^3 ) (for ( y = 3x^4 + 2 ))
- ( y' = 9x^2 ) (for ( y = 3x^3 - 1 ))
